Transaction 23f0252378e8a71ed602376c13c583cd9d2a3d902a42432cc413b8f941464230
1 Input
2 Outputs
- 23f0252378e8a71ed602376c13c583cd9d2a3d902a42432cc413b8f941464230:0
- 23f0252378e8a71ed602376c13c583cd9d2a3d902a42432cc413b8f941464230:1
value 20000000
address 36UKypuhY8jZX3LAphxKwXqvg3QazyAKJc
value 721499040
address 141Uues55NmVnTiQgzz5kND7oCbddCuzqH